Vice President of Development
**Position is required to be in Austin, TX, full-time**JOB DESCRIPTION: VP of Development: This position provides strategic, leadership management of planning, directing, and implementing HeartGift’s fundraising and donor development efforts in collaboration with the CEO and other senior leadership team members. The VP of Development is responsible for designing, executing, and scaling a comprehensive development program to support HeartGift’s mission. This role leads all giving activities, including major gifts, corporate partnerships, events, grants, and donor engagement. The VP of Development will lead the Development Team to reach annual income goals, including a diversified revenue stream and sustainable growth to align with HeartGift’s strategic plan.
